Pit 98: Level 1

Completed October 9, 2016 by David and Odess Brinkman, and DC Locke. This was a post Hurricane Matthew dig. Despite about 5 inches of rain (the day before), a tarp over the pit area kept things dry enough to dig and sift. Once again, between the Judas and Magnolia trees, we had a lot of roots to deal with. Just like the adjacent pit 97, there was not much in the way of artifacts except what looks like a few small pieces of Native American pottery.

Pit 98: Level 1 produced: 1 stoneware piece, 2 pieces of glass, 3 Native American pieces, and 2 charcoal pieces.
